摘要

A PTO drive for a farm or construction work utility vehicle has a PTO clutch (3) via which one of an internal combustion engine (1) driven input shaft (2) with a drivingly connected to a PTO stub shaft (17) output shaft is coupled. The PTO clutch (3) is hydraulically actuated via a proportional valve in an engaged position and serves as an overload clutch on which by means of transducers and an electronic control unit when exceeding a limit value of a torque transmitted by this detectable slippage is determined. The occurrence of a slip via the electronic control unit (25) and the proportional valve (20) to an actuation of the PTO clutch (3) in its disengaged position. In order to avoid overloading and slippage leading to wear on the PTO clutch serving as an overload clutch in all operating states, a pressure p present in a hydraulic actuator (21) of the PTO clutch (3) is applied directly to it in its engaged position As proportional to the transmitted by means of the PTO clutch (3) torque Man, wherein via the electronic control unit (25) based on a characteristic of each transmittable torque, a corresponding pressure p, with which the PTO clutch (3) of the PTO drive is operated.
